

L’adresse IP 127.0.0.1 est connue sous le nom de « localhost ». Elle est utilisée pour désigner l’ordinateur local lui-même dans le réseau. Cette adresse est essentielle pour les développeurs web, car elle permet de tester des applications sur leur propre machine sans avoir besoin d’un serveur externe. Le port 49342 est un numéro arbitraire qui peut être utilisé pour distinguer différentes applications fonctionnant simultanément sur le même appareil, facilitant ainsi la gestion des connexions et des processus.
Dans un contexte de développement, « localhost » est employé pour accéder à des applications qui s’exécutent localement. Lorsque vous tapez 127.0.0.1 dans votre navigateur, vous vous connectez à votre propre machine, vous permettant d’exécuter et de tester des logiciels en temps réel. L’utilisation d’un port spécifique comme 49342 permet à ces tests de se dérouler simultanément avec d’autres activités réseau, chaque port servant de canal distinct pour les communications.
L’utilisation de 127.0.0.1 avec un port comme 49342 est cruciale pour le développement web car elle permet de tester des applications dans un environnement contrôlé. Cela signifie que les développeurs peuvent repérer et rectifier des bugs ou des comportements anormaux avant de déployer leurs applications sur des serveurs publics. Cela assure que les applications seront stables et sécurisées une fois en ligne. De plus, cela facilite le développement en cycle court, permettant des retours rapides et des ajustements fréquents.
L’un des principaux avantages de travailler avec localhost et un port spécifique comme 49342 est la capacité de simuler un environnement de test réaliste. Les développeurs peuvent configurer leur application pour qu’elle se comporte comme elle le ferait si elle était en ligne, sans les risques et contraintes associés à un déploiement prématuré. De plus, le contrôle total sur les paramètres locaux permet une plus grande flexibilité et personnalisation. On peut ainsi reproduire des situations spécifiques de manière ciblée, ce qui est particulièrement utile pour le développement agile et découvertes de failles de sécurité.
Pour que le développement local avec 127.0.0.1 et un port comme 49342 soit efficace, il est crucial de bien configurer votre environnement. Cela inclut l’utilisation de serveurs locaux comme Apache ou Nginx, qui permettent de simuler un environnement de serveur réel sur votre machine. Vous devez également vous assurer que votre logiciel de pare-feu local permet des connexions sur le port que vous avez choisi d’utiliser pour éviter les problèmes d’accès. Une documentation claire et une sauvegarde régulière des configurations peuvent également éviter des pertes de temps en cas de problème.
Plusieurs outils facilitent l’exécution de serveurs web locaux. Parmi eux, XAMPP et WAMP sont populaires pour leurs interfaces conviviales qui simplifient le processus de mise en place d’un environnement de test sur votre machine locale. Docker, une autre technologie puissante, permet de contenir des applications et leurs dépendances pour isoler des environnements spécifiques. Des IDE comme Visual Studio Code et PhpStorm offrent des fonctionnalités intégrées qui simplifient le débogage et la gestion de vos serveurs locaux, optimisant ainsi votre flux de travail.
Il n’est pas rare de rencontrer des erreurs lors de l’utilisation de 127.0.0.1:49342. L’une des plus courantes est « Connexion refusée », souvent due à un problème de serveur non lancé ou de configuration de pare-feu. Pour résoudre cela, vérifiez d’abord que votre serveur local est en fonctionnement et que le port est ouvert dans vos paramètres de sécurité. D’autres erreurs peuvent inclure des conflits de port, où deux applications tentent d’utiliser le même numéro de port. Dans ce cas, modifiez le port de l’une des applications pour éviter les conflits.
Bien que travailler en local élimine de nombreux risques associés aux serveurs distants, la sécurité reste une priorité. Assurez-vous que votre système d’exploitation est à jour pour éviter toute vulnérabilité. De plus, configurez votre pare-feu pour restreindre l’accès aux ports ouverts uniquement aux applications fiables. Une bonne pratique consiste aussi à développer vos applications avec des pratiques de codage sécurisé pour éviter que des vulnérabilités ne soient transportées à la mise en ligne.
L’utilisation de « localhost » et de ports spécifiques permet aux développeurs de simuler des scénarios réels directement sur leurs machines locales. Par exemple, vous pouvez imiter les conditions de charge serveur en lançant plusieurs sessions de test simultanément. Cela aide à identifier comment une application se comportera sous pression, crucial pour évaluer sa stabilité et performance avant son déploiement. Vous pouvez également simuler des pannes de réseau pour voir comment votre application gère les interruptions de service.
Avec l’évolution rapide des technologies web, 127.0.0.1 reste un outil pertinent. Il sert de base pour l’intégration continue et le déploiement continu, où les développeurs s’assurent que les mises à jour ne cassent pas la version actuelle d’une application. Les technologies comme Kubernetes et Docker utilisent également la notion de développement local pour permettre le test en conteneur, garantissant que l’application peut s’exécuter sur n’importe quel environnement avec la même fiabilité et performance.
Bien que nous n’incluions pas de conclusion à proprement parler, il est clair qu’une compréhension approfondie de 127.0.0.1:49342 et de son utilisation peut considérablement améliorer l’efficacité et la sécurité du développement web. En maximisant ces outils, les développeurs peuvent non seulement élaborer des applications robustes, mais aussi raccourcir leurs cycles de développement, accélérant le temps de mise sur le marché.
